WebA tax code is usually shown on your payslip, alongside your pay or pension information. It will also be on the coding notice you might receive from HMRC, the P60 you get after the end of the tax year and the P45 if you change jobs. If you get a voicemail or message which worries you or you think might be a scam, you should report it so no one else falls victim to it and it can be investigated. WebDec 18, 2024 · Changing your tax code If your tax code is incorrect, you will need to change it to avoid paying the wrong amount to HMRC. There’s three ways to do this: online, over the phone, or with the help of professional accountancy services. WebApr 6, 2024 · In these situations, HMRC’s P800 tax calculation system, may mean you do not need to claim a repayment, as HMRC might issue a repayment automatically. If you have not received a P800 tax calculation from HMRC, and you have overpaid tax, you will need to make a claim for a tax repayment. This is described below. What is a P800 tax calculation?
